CIRCUIT DESCRIPTION
Voltage is applied to the normally open inlet valves whenever the main relay is energized. An inlet valve closes when the Electronic Brake/Traction Control Module (EBCM/EBTCM) supplies a ground path at the inlet valve control terminal. The EBCM/EBTCM closes the LF inlet valve for short periods to maintain (hold) or reduce pressure at the LF wheel.
CONDITIONS FOR SETTING THE DTC
DTC C1245 sets when the EBCM/EBTCM detects an open or short to ground in the LF inlet valve circuit.
ACTION TAKEN WHEN THE DTC SETS
A malfunction DTC is stored, ABS is disabled and the ANTILOCK indicator lamp is turned ON.
CONDITIONS FOR CLEARING THE DTC
^ Conditions for the malfunction are no longer present and scan tool clear DTCs function is used.
^ 100 ignition switch key cycles have passed with no malfunctions detected.
DIAGNOSTIC AIDS
It is very important that a thorough inspection of the wiring and connectors be performed. Failure to carefully inspect wiring may result in misdiagnosis, causing part replacement with reappearance of the malfunction.
